Best time Arrive early or visit on weekdays to avoid crowds and heat — reviewers noted Saturday visits weren't packed, and the playground equipment becomes too hot to use safely in direct sun
Visitor tip Bring extra clothes and towels for toddlers — the splash pad features water spouts and water guns that spray directly, which can overwhelm younger children who prefer gentler water play

What visitors say

Such a fun time for the kids! We went on a Saturday, 6/7 and it was not packed. There are benches to sit on and also picnic tables to eat at. 10/10 recommend. Very clean as well. Ps. No public restrooms!! Keep that in mind
